Avolon has agreed a sale-and-leaseback transaction with India’s Akasa Air covering up to seven Boeing 737-8200 aircraft.
The deal expands the aviation finance company’s existing partnership with Akasa and will support the airline’s continued fleet growth and network development in the Indian market.
The 737-8200 is the highest-capacity variant of the 737-8 MAX, offering improved operating economics alongside lower fuel consumption and emissions compared with previous-generation aircraft.
Avolon said the type has attracted strong airline demand as operators seek greater efficiency while expanding their networks.
